SOUTH OSSETIA TO OPEN EMBASSY IN ABKHAZIA
00:00, 15 April, 2008
SUKHUMI, APRIL 15, ARMENPRESS:Leaders of two unrecognized republics of Abkhazia and South Ossetia, which
broke away from Georgia in early 1990-s, are negotiating in Sukhumi, the
capital of Abkhazia, behind closed doors, Russian Interfax news agency
said.
It said Sergey Bagapsh of Abkhazia and Eduard Kokoity of South Ossetia are
expected to sign agreements on cooperation between their customs services
and trade and industry chambers.
Interfax quoted Valery Arshba, chief of Bagapsh’s staff, as saying that
South Ossetia plans to open embassy in Sukhumi.
